玖月贰拾
码龄3年
关注
提问 私信
  • 博客:21,012
    21,012
    总访问量
  • 29
    原创
  • 1,263,916
    排名
  • 217
    粉丝
  • 0
    铁粉
  • 学习成就
IP属地以运营商信息为准,境内显示到省(区、市),境外显示到国家(地区)
IP 属地:辽宁省
  • 加入CSDN时间: 2021-11-30
博客简介:

liqinkuaia的博客

查看详细资料
  • 原力等级
    成就
    当前等级
    1
    当前总分
    60
    当月
    2
个人成就
  • 获得313次点赞
  • 内容获得15次评论
  • 获得299次收藏
创作历程
  • 29篇
    2024年
成就勋章
创作活动更多

仓颉编程语言体验有奖征文

仓颉编程语言官网已上线,提供版本下载、在线运行、文档体验等功能。为鼓励更多开发者探索仓颉编程语言,现诚邀各位开发者通过官网在线体验/下载使用,参与仓颉体验有奖征文活动。

368人参与 去创作
  • 最近
  • 文章
  • 代码仓
  • 资源
  • 问答
  • 帖子
  • 视频
  • 课程
  • 关注/订阅/互动
  • 收藏
搜TA的内容
搜索 取消

Spark在金融行业的应用:风险评估与反欺诈系统构建

Spark以其强大的分布式计算能力和丰富的数据处理与机器学习库,为金融行业的风险评估和反欺诈系统构建提供了有力的支持。未来,随着技术的不断发展和应用场景的不断拓展,Spark在金融行业的应用将更加广泛和深入。:使用Spark MLlib中的分类和回归算法,如逻辑回归、随机森林等,训练风险评估模型,并对模型进行评估和优化。:使用Spark的数据处理能力,对来自不同数据源的数据进行整合和清洗,得到规范化的数据集。:对检测到的异常交易进行实时预警,并触发相应的响应机制,如拦截交易、人工审核等。
原创
发布博客 2024.01.08 ·
688 阅读 ·
10 点赞 ·
0 评论 ·
9 收藏

Spark数据可视化:使用Spark与Tableau/Power BI进行数据可视化分析

通过Spark与Tableau/Power BI的集成,我们可以实现大数据的高效处理和直观的可视化分析。首先,我们需要明确在使用Tableau或Power BI进行数据可视化之前,Spark在整个数据处理流程中的角色。集成后,用户可以在Tableau中创建各种图表、仪表板,并利用Tableau的交互功能进行深入的数据探索。与Tableau类似,Power BI也提供了丰富的可视化组件和交互功能,用户可以创建报告、仪表板等。Power BI是微软推出的一款商业智能工具,也可以与Spark进行集成。
原创
发布博客 2024.01.08 ·
1572 阅读 ·
24 点赞 ·
0 评论 ·
21 收藏

Spark在物联网(IoT)数据分析中的应用

通过利用Spark的速度快、通用性强和可扩展性好等优势,我们可以高效地处理和分析物联网数据,挖掘其中的价值。未来,随着物联网技术的不断发展和Spark社区的不断壮大,我们相信Spark在物联网数据分析中的应用将会更加广泛和深入。随着物联网(IoT)技术的飞速发展,越来越多的设备被连接到互联网,产生了海量的数据。Apache Spark作为一个快速、通用的大规模数据处理引擎,在物联网数据分析中发挥着越来越重要的作用。我们从本地的9999端口读取模拟的物联网数据,对数据进行简单的处理,然后打印处理结果。
原创
发布博客 2024.01.08 ·
474 阅读 ·
6 点赞 ·
0 评论 ·
8 收藏

Spark与Kafka集成:构建高吞吐量的实时数据处理管道

通过将它们集成在一起,我们可以构建一个高吞吐量的实时数据处理管道,以满足不断增长的业务需求。通过优化和扩展,我们可以进一步提高管道的性能和可靠性,为业务增长和创新提供有力支持。Spark支持多种编程语言,包括Scala、Java、Python和R,并提供了丰富的数据处理和分析功能。并行度和分区:根据集群资源和数据量,可以调整Spark任务的并行度和Kafka主题的分区数,以提高处理能力和吞吐量。数据序列化:为了提高数据传输和处理的效率,可以选择合适的数据序列化格式,如Avro、Parquet等。
原创
发布博客 2024.01.08 ·
542 阅读 ·
5 点赞 ·
0 评论 ·
12 收藏

Spark在机器学习中的实践:信用评分模型的开发与部署

借助Spark强大的数据处理能力和丰富的机器学习库MLlib,我们可以高效地进行数据预处理、模型训练和调优,同时还可以选择多种灵活的模型部署方式。通过对借款人的个人信息、历史信用记录、财务状况等数据进行挖掘和分析,信用评分模型可以对借款人的信用状况进行评估,并给出一个量化的信用评分。以PMML为例,我们可以使用Spark MLlib的PMML模型导出功能将训练好的模型导出为PMML文件,然后将PMML文件部署到支持PMML的模型服务器上,如OpenScoring等。四、信用评分模型的部署。
原创
发布博客 2024.01.08 ·
506 阅读 ·
10 点赞 ·
0 评论 ·
10 收藏

Spark在实时流处理中的应用:构建实时日志分析系统

Apache Spark作为一个快速、通用的大规模数据处理引擎,提供了强大的流处理功能,能够很好地满足实时数据处理的需求。通过本文的介绍,我们可以看到Spark Streaming在实时日志分析系统中的应用非常广泛。借助Spark Streaming强大的实时处理能力,我们可以轻松构建出一个高效、可扩展的实时日志分析系统,以满足企业在大数据时代对实时数据处理的需求。实时日志分析系统主要负责收集、处理和分析系统产生的实时日志数据,以便及时发现系统异常、了解用户行为和优化系统性能。二、实时日志分析系统概述。
原创
发布博客 2024.01.08 ·
557 阅读 ·
8 点赞 ·
0 评论 ·
9 收藏

Spark与Hadoop生态系统集成:HDFS、Hive和HBase的交互使用

为了更好地利用这两个框架的优势,很多企业将Spark与Hadoop生态系统进行集成,实现数据的高效处理和存储。首先,需要将Hive的相关jar包添加到Spark的classpath中,然后在Spark中创建一个HiveContext或SparkSession对象,就可以使用Hive的SQL查询功能了。Spark可以通过Hadoop的API直接访问HDFS上的数据,实现数据的读取和写入。Spark通过集成Hive,可以直接使用Hive的元数据和SQL查询功能,实现对Hive表的数据处理。
原创
发布博客 2024.01.08 ·
624 阅读 ·
9 点赞 ·
0 评论 ·
12 收藏

Spark集群部署与管理:打造稳定高效的大数据平台

在部署Spark集群之前,首先需要进行充分的规划,包括集群的规模、硬件配置、网络拓扑结构等。通过合理的集群部署和管理策略,我们可以打造一个稳定高效的Spark大数据平台,满足日益增长的大数据处理需求。未来,随着技术的不断发展和业务需求的变化,我们还需要不断探索和优化Spark集群的部署与管理方案,以适应新的挑战和机遇。设置集群的主节点(Master)和工作节点(Worker)的相关信息,如主机名、端口号等。:选择适合的操作系统和Java版本,安装必要的依赖库和工具,如Scala、Hadoop等。
原创
发布博客 2024.01.08 ·
349 阅读 ·
8 点赞 ·
0 评论 ·
10 收藏

Spark性能调优:优化大数据处理任务的技巧

综上所述,通过合理配置资源、优化数据分区和缓存、解决数据倾斜、调整并行度和任务粒度、使用广播变量和累加器、优化Shuffle操作、选择合适的操作和数据结构以及监控和调试,可以有效地提高Spark的性能,优化大数据处理任务。合理调整任务的并行度和任务粒度可以提高Spark的性能。另外,对于频繁访问的数据,可以使用Spark的缓存机制将其缓存到内存中,避免重复计算,提高性能。可以使用Spark UI、Spark Metrics、资源监控工具等来监控集群和应用的性能指标,定位问题并进行相应的优化。
原创
发布博客 2024.01.08 ·
987 阅读 ·
8 点赞 ·
0 评论 ·
12 收藏

Spark GraphX图计算:社交网络分析和推荐系统实践

Apache Spark的GraphX库是一个强大的图计算框架,它允许用户在大规模图数据上进行高效的并行计算,从而解决社交网络分析和推荐系统等问题。在社交网络中,我们可以将用户视为顶点,用户之间的关系视为边,然后应用PageRank算法来计算每个用户的影响力。一种常见的推荐算法是基于物品的协同过滤。在该算法中,我们将用户和物品表示为图中的顶点,用户和物品之间的交互(如评分、购买)表示为边。然后,我们可以利用GraphX中的图算法来计算物品之间的相似度,并根据用户的历史行为来推荐相似的物品。
原创
发布博客 2024.01.08 ·
772 阅读 ·
8 点赞 ·
0 评论 ·
8 收藏

Spark MLlib机器学习库:常用算法及其实战应用

MLlib支持多种常见的机器学习任务,如分类、回归、聚类、协同过滤等,并且具有高效、可扩展和易用的特点。首先,需要收集一批已标记为垃圾邮件或非垃圾邮件的邮件样本,提取邮件中的特征(如发件人、邮件正文中的关键词等),然后使用逻辑回归算法训练模型。我们可以使用MLlib中的K-means算法对客户数据进行聚类分析,提取客户的特征(如购买历史、消费习惯等),并根据聚类结果制定相应的营销策略。聚类算法用于将数据集划分为多个不同的簇,使得同一簇内的数据相似度较高,不同簇之间的数据相似度较低。
原创
发布博客 2024.01.08 ·
686 阅读 ·
10 点赞 ·
0 评论 ·
10 收藏

Spark SQL实战:高效进行大数据查询分析

本文将深入介绍Spark SQL的核心概念、使用技巧,并通过实战示例展示其在大数据查询分析中的强大能力。通过本文的介绍,我们了解了Spark SQL在大数据查询分析中的核心概念和使用技巧,并通过实战示例展示了其强大的查询分析能力。在实际应用中,用户可以根据具体的数据和业务需求,灵活运用Spark SQL提供的各种功能和优化手段,实现高效、准确的大数据查询分析。DataSet是DataFrame的扩展,提供了类型安全的数据处理能力,但在实际应用中,由于DataFrame的易用性和广泛支持,往往更受欢迎。
原创
发布博客 2024.01.08 ·
1094 阅读 ·
19 点赞 ·
0 评论 ·
20 收藏

Spark Core详解:RDD与DataFrame的使用技巧

在实际应用中,你可以根据具体的需求选择使用RDD还是DataFrame,或者将它们结合使用,以充分利用Spark的性能和灵活性。Apache Spark Core是Spark大数据处理框架的核心组件,它提供了RDD(弹性分布式数据集)和DataFrame两种基本的数据抽象,用于在分布式环境中处理大规模数据集。本篇文章将深入讲解RDD和DataFrame的概念、创建、转换和操作,并通过示例代码展示它们的使用技巧。与RDD不同的是,DataFrame的操作更加高级和声明式,Spark能够根据这些操作进行优化。
原创
发布博客 2024.01.08 ·
479 阅读 ·
10 点赞 ·
0 评论 ·
5 收藏

Spark入门指南:快速搭建大数据处理环境

Apache Spark是一个开源的、大数据处理框架,它提供了简单而强大的编程接口,支持多种语言(如Scala、Java、Python和R),并允许你以分布式方式处理大规模数据集。现在,你可以开始探索Spark的强大功能,并编写你自己的大数据处理程序了。: 虽然Spark支持多种编程语言,但Scala是其原生支持的语言,并且Spark的核心API是用Scala编写的。接下来,你可以开始编写你自己的Spark程序了。此外,你还可以通过运行Spark自带的示例程序来验证Spark的安装。
原创
发布博客 2024.01.08 ·
324 阅读 ·
11 点赞 ·
0 评论 ·
7 收藏

未来趋势:Spark在人工智能和物联网领域的发展前景

随着技术的不断进步,大数据、人工智能(AI)和物联网(IoT)已经成为推动数字化转型的三大核心力量。在这三大领域中,Apache Spark作为一种高效的大数据处理框架,正发挥着越来越重要的作用。随着技术的不断发展,Spark在人工智能和物联网领域的应用将越来越广泛。未来,我们可以期待看到更多创新的Spark应用在这两个领域中涌现,推动数字化转型的进程。物联网设备产生的大量实时数据需要高效的处理和分析能力。Spark以其分布式计算能力和内存计算优势,为AI算法的训练和部署提供了强大的支持。
原创
发布博客 2024.01.04 ·
1385 阅读 ·
23 点赞 ·
1 评论 ·
19 收藏

从MapReduce迁移到Spark:优势与挑战

可以看到,使用Spark的代码更加简洁和直观,同时提供了更多的操作选项(如flatMap、map、reduceByKey等)。:Spark不仅支持Map和Reduce操作,还提供了诸如filter、join、groupBy等丰富的转换和动作操作,使得数据处理更加灵活和高效。:Spark以其基于内存的计算模型而闻名,能够显著减少磁盘I/O操作,从而在处理迭代计算和交互式查询时提供比MapReduce更快的性能。:Spark提供了统一的API来处理批处理和流数据,简化了开发和维护的复杂性。
原创
发布博客 2024.01.04 ·
408 阅读 ·
9 点赞 ·
1 评论 ·
8 收藏

Apache Spark在实时日志分析中的应用

通过不断优化Spark集群的配置和性能、探索新的数据处理和分析算法、以及与机器学习和人工智能技术的结合,我们可以期待实时日志分析在帮助企业做出更快更准确的决策方面发挥更大的作用。Apache Spark,作为一个快速、通用的大规模数据处理引擎,凭借其流处理框架Spark Streaming,在实时日志分析领域展现出了强大的能力。Spark Streaming是Spark的核心组件之一,它可以将连续的数据流切分成一系列微小的批处理作业,每个作业的处理时间通常在几百毫秒到几秒之间。最后,我们打印出统计结果。
原创
发布博客 2024.01.04 ·
431 阅读 ·
9 点赞 ·
1 评论 ·
8 收藏

构建高效Spark集群的硬件配置建议

除了硬件配置外,有效的集群管理和监控也是确保Spark集群高效运行的关键方面。监控集群的性能指标(如CPU使用率、内存消耗、网络带宽和存储容量)并及时作出调整可以保持集群的最佳状态。然而,要充分发挥Spark的潜力,一个高效的集群硬件配置是至关重要的。综上所述,构建高效的Spark集群需要综合考虑节点规模、CPU和内存资源、存储和网络配置等多个方面。通过合理的硬件选择和持续的集群管理监控,可以确保Spark集群在处理大规模数据时提供卓越的性能和可扩展性。
原创
发布博客 2024.01.04 ·
490 阅读 ·
7 点赞 ·
1 评论 ·
7 收藏

Spark与Kubernetes集成:简化大数据处理流程

在大数据处理和分析领域,Apache Spark因其卓越的性能和灵活的数据处理能力而受到广泛关注。将Spark与Kubernetes集成,可以大大简化大数据处理流程,提高资源利用率和作业执行效率。在部署过程中,可以使用Spark的Kubernetes调度器来管理作业的执行。这个调度器可以与Kubernetes API进行交互,根据作业的资源需求动态创建和销毁Pod(Kubernetes中的最小部署单元)。此外,还可以使用Spark的原生API来编写和提交作业,而无需关心底层的容器编排细节。
原创
发布博客 2024.01.04 ·
375 阅读 ·
5 点赞 ·
1 评论 ·
5 收藏

Spark与Python:PySpark的魅力与应用

在大数据处理和分析的领域中,Apache Spark已经成为了一个不可或缺的工具。而Python,作为一种简洁、易读且功能强大的编程语言,也受到了数据科学家和工程师的广泛喜爱。当这两者结合时,便诞生了PySpark——一个让Python开发者能够轻松利用Spark强大功能的库。本文将深入探讨PySpark的魅力与应用,并通过示例代码展示其在实际场景中的使用。在实际场景中,开发者可以根据需求进行更加复杂的数据处理和分析操作。接着,我们进行了数据清洗(删除空值行)和数据转换(将某列的值转换为大写)操作。
原创
发布博客 2024.01.04 ·
564 阅读 ·
6 点赞 ·
1 评论 ·
8 收藏
加载更多